Features

  • ULTRA-LIGHTWEIGHT, STREAMLINED DESIGN: For incredible maneuverability and less user fatigue.
  • DUAL-EXIT CUTTING HEAD: For greater cutting efficiency.
  • AUTOMATIC-FEED SPOOL SYSTEM: For effortless line advancementle line advancement.
  • SAME BATTERY, EXPANDABLE POWER: WORX Power Share is compatible with all WORX 20V and 40V tools, outdoor power and lifestyle products.
  • ADJUSTABLE AUXILIARY HANDLE: For a comfortable, and customized, user experience.
  • INCLUDES: Grass trimmer, spool (WA0007), (2) 20v 2.0 Ah batteries (WA3575), 2.0 Ah dual-charger (WA3770).

Brand: WORX


Power Source: Battery Powered


Color: Black and Orange


Item Weight: 6.4 Pounds


Cutting Width: 13 Inches


Power Source: Battery Powered


Cutting width: 13 Inches


Speed: 7000 RPM


Number of Batteries: 2 Lithium Ion batteries required. (included)


Is Product Cordless: Yes


Item Weight: 6.4 Pounds


Item Dimensions L x W: 63"L x 14.7"W


Size: No Size


Color: Black and Orange


Style Name: 13" Trimmer w/(2) 2.0 Ah Batteries


Required Assembly: Yes


Brand Name: WORX


Model Number: WG183


Global Trade Identification Number: 25


Number of Items: 1


Recommended Uses For Product: Trimming


UPC: 845534023725


Manufacturer Part Number: WG183


Item Type Name: WORX WG183 13'' Cordless String Trimmer


Unit Count: 1.0 Count


Manufacturer: Positec Technology (China) Co., Ltd

  • Worx 40 volt two line trimmer
Style: 13" Trimmer w/(2) 2.0 Ah Batteries
This is 40 volt trimmer using two 20 volt batteries in series. It has a 2string spool and is as powerful as most gas trimmers that I have used. The batteries are interchangeable with other Worx equipment.

  • Brand new and quit. But I know why! Blown capasitor ie bad component on the board. Brand new and quit. But I know why! Blown capasitor ie bad component on the board.
Style: 13" Trimmer w/(2) 2.0 Ah Batteries
I had this exact weed eater for about 2 years and it performed above and beyond. It sure was my favorite tool to use. I have many Worx equipment. A battery lawn mower, a blower, weed eater, I am a woman in my 70’s and live on a farm. I love the battery equipment that provide real progress on maintenance. But when I ordered a new weedeater I didn’t have it for 30 days, only used it 3 times and it quit. I was stumped. It wasn’t the motor or anything I could troubleshoot so I opened it up and there was the obvious problem! The capasitor on the board in the handle had blown. See picture. You can see the weed eater is brand new. It’s still clean! Ha! But the fact that this weed eater is dead from a component failure is disturbing. No one wants to hassle with bad components being an issue. So now I’m out the money I spent and I don’t want to double down and have this happen again. But I really loved this weedeater. I don’t want to have to switch brands now with 10 batteries for all my tools. I’m not a complainer and components are very seldom cause for failure but this is unfortunate for me as I am not sure of chancing buying another one now. I really didn’t pay attention to what kind of warrantee it had but I’m sure they don’t like you opening up the case but you can see the capasitor is foaming out and blown. I’m figuring I’m just out the money. But at least I know why it quit after 3 uses. So buyer be warned. ... show more
